Output 54cb3994d81f3a84c78a1f7e1396f8140a6be6551f492ded4015b92095b4bf62:0

value
28250900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ee0b287b81e751d878d15c25e629348dd25de93 OP_EQUAL
address
MGYpvi9C3PCeCZotGAysKRDQV7ifKWJWTk
transaction
54cb3994d81f3a84c78a1f7e1396f8140a6be6551f492ded4015b92095b4bf62
spent
true